The cheapest way to get from Bambang to Dagupan is to drive which costs ₱1,000 - ₱1,600 and takes 2h 19m.
The fastest way to get from Bambang to Dagupan is to drive which takes 2h 19m and costs ₱1,000 - ₱1,600.
No, there is no direct bus from Bambang to Dagupan. However, there are services departing from Bambang and arriving at Dagupan via Solano, Bontoc and Baguio.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 26m.
The distance between Bambang and Dagupan is 379 km. The road distance is 137.7 km.
The best way to get from Bambang to Dagupan without a car is to bus via Bontoc which takes 13h 26m and costs .
It takes approximately 13h 26m to get from Bambang to Dagupan, including transfers.
Bambang to Dagupan bus services, operated by Coda Lines Corporation, depart from Solano station.
Bambang to Dagupan bus services, operated by Coda Lines Corporation, arrive at Bontoc station.
Yes, the driving distance between Bambang to Dagupan is 138 km. It takes approximately 2h 19m to drive from Bambang to Dagupan.
